WebApr 12, 2024 · If you made a net profit of $400 or more from your side hustle, you have to pay taxes on it, according to the IRS. “Any earned income is subject to taxes and when … WebJun 6, 2024 · When it comes to investment income, the "source" in this case is where you were at the time you earned it. Since many investments (such as dividends), are reported yearly, it can be very difficult to determine exactly when they were earned. Thus you can use another method of allocation: percentages. Use your wages as the guide.

WebMar 19, 2024 · For purchased inventory, all sales income attributable to a U.S. office would be U.S. source. In either case, any U.S. source income would generally be ECI under Section 864 (c) (3). The IRS also points out the apparent overlap of Section 865 (e) (2) with Section 864 (c) (4) (B) (iii).
